Analysis

In 2017, service imports in Barbados stood at 686.96 million BoP, current US$.

That represents a change of down 0.7% on the previous year and up 19.6% over ten years.

Over the whole period, service imports in Barbados peaked at 745.25 million BoP, current US$ in 2013 and was at its lowest, 19.49 million BoP, current US$, in 1967.

Barbados ranks 160th of 199 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Averages by decade

DecadeAverage LowestHighest Years
1960s 23.91 million BoP, current US$ 19.49 million BoP, current US$ 28.69 million BoP, current US$ 3
1970s 50.79 million BoP, current US$ 32.85 million BoP, current US$ 90.02 million BoP, current US$ 10
1980s 138.27 million BoP, current US$ 113.71 million BoP, current US$ 171.25 million BoP, current US$ 10
1990s 226.59 million BoP, current US$ 149.35 million BoP, current US$ 317.86 million BoP, current US$ 10
2000s 491.51 million BoP, current US$ 359.26 million BoP, current US$ 662.60 million BoP, current US$ 10
2010s 656.92 million BoP, current US$ 520.91 million BoP, current US$ 745.25 million BoP, current US$ 8

Imports of services are services provided by non-residents to residents. This indicator is expressed in current prices, meaning no adjustment has been made to account for price changes over time. This indicator is expressed in United States dollars.
